Speaking in a televised interview on TVC News, Bago stated plainly: “I did not ban evangelism in Niger State.” He explained that the order came from the Religious Affairs department, which now requires clerics scheduled to preach on Fridays to submit their sermons for prior screening. He noted that such reviews are standard practice in some countries, including Saudi Arabia.

The clarification highlights that the initiative is aimed at regulation rather than prohibition, with its goal being to curb hate speech and promote religious tolerance across the state’s diverse communities.

Still, the governor’s reference to Saudi Arabia—a country with a vastly different religious and political system—has sparked mixed reactions. While some consider it a reasonable step toward stability, others see it as government overreach that could undermine religious liberty, a right firmly protected by Nigeria’s constitution. Bago’s explanation has put the policy in the spotlight, and debates are expected to intensify as religious leaders and citizens weigh the tension between maintaining security and safeguarding freedoms.
